POSITION SUMMARY
DCIM Technical Support Analyst will provide software support and troubleshooting to clients on all aspects of the DCIM Software. This may include implementation, existing software and upgrades to the software. Provide troubleshooting and analysis of software bugs for our customers by working in a cross fuctional team enviroment. Properly escalating client issues based on severity to meet expected SLA time frames.
 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IESResponsibilities include:
  • Using multiple ticketing systems – submitting, updating, closing tickets in a timely fashion.
  • Researching, resolving and responding to customer questions received via telephone, email or support portal working under supervision.
  • Setup and configure Sunbird’s DCIM suite including dcTrack and Power IQ.
  • Facilitate timely resolution of customers’ issues by logging and maintaining resolution status in corporate tracking system working under supervision.
  • Participate in online training session for clients and partners to maintain up-to-date knowledge of Sunbird’s software suite enhancements.
  • Data center surveys and audits as needed
 REQUIREMENTS/QUALIFICATIONS 
  • Associates degree in a technical discipline or equivalent experience.
  • One year experience providing customer support for a technical environment.
  • Excellent customer-facing project management, analysis, troubleshooting, and technical skills.
  • Demonstrated basic technical knowledge of:
    • Computer hardware (rack servers, PDUs, and cabling)
    • Windows 7 / Windows 10
  • Ability to work flexible hours with the possibility of travel up to 10%.
  • Accountability and the ability to adapt/multi-task/manage changing priorities.
  • Self-motivated, ability to learn and apply new skills quickly
  • Good oral/written communication and interpersonal skills required
  • Adaptable/flexible -- enjoys doing work that requires frequent shifts in direction
  • Reports to the office daily. With a possibility of limited remote work
 DESIRED SOFTWARE SKILLS/KNOWLEDGE 
  • Microsoft Office Suite including Outlook, Word, Excel, Zoom Conference Software, Fresh Desk Ticketing Software, Fresh Chat, Jira, MS Teams, Slack, Web Browser Configurations, etc.
  • General database SQL knowledgePOSITION SUMMARY

What We Do

Sunbird Software is changing the way data centers are being managed. With a focus on real user scenarios for real customer problems, we help data center operators manage tasks and processes faster and more efficient than ever before, while saving costs and improving availability. We strive to eliminate the complexity they have been forced to accept from point tools and home grown applications, removing the dependency on emails and spreadsheets to transform the delivery of data center services. Sunbird delivers on this commitment with unexpected simplicity through products that are easy to find, buy, deploy, use, and maintain. Our solutions are rooted in our deep connections with our customers who share best practices and participate in our user groups and product development process.
